How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 30022?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
30022 Studio Apartments | $2,119 | $1,985 | $2,814 |
30022 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,006 | $850 | $4,066 |
30022 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,490 | $1,272 | $5,619 |
30022 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,002 | $1,590 | $5,712 |
30022 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,097 | $2,550 | $9,800 |
